Key Features of the Ram 1500 Limited: What Makes It Premium?
Even when used, the Ram 1500 Limited stands out due to its extensive list of standard and available features that elevate it above other trims and competitors. Understanding these will help you appreciate the value proposition:
- Exquisite Interior: Expect premium Natura Plus leather, open-pore wood, and genuine metal trim. The attention to detail is evident in every stitch and surface.
- Advanced Infotainment: The centerpiece is often the massive 12-inch Uconnect touchscreen, offering navigation,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and a host of vehicle controls.
- Air Suspension: The optional (and often standard on Limited) Active-Level Four-Corner Air Suspension provides a remarkably smooth ride, adjustable ride height for easier entry/exit, and improved aerodynamics at highway speeds.
- Safety and Driver-Assist Technologies: Modern Limited models come equipped with features like ad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ning, blind-spot monitoring, forward collision warning, and a 360-degree surround-view camera system.
- Premium Audio: Often equipped with a Harman Kardon 19-speaker audio system, providing an immersive sound experience.
- Multi-Function Tailgate (optional): The innovative Multi-Function Tailgate offers 60/40 split swing-away doors and a traditional drop-down function, enhancing versatility for loading and accessing the bed.
- Engine Options: Predominantly found with the 5.7L HEMI V8 (with or without eTorque mild-hybrid assist) for strong performance, or the 3.0L EcoDiesel V6 for impressive fuel economy and torque.

Potential Challenges and Solutions
While buying used offers great value, it’s not without potential hurdles:
- Wear and Tear: Used vehicles will naturally show signs of use.
- Solution: A thorough inspection will identify excessive wear. Factor potential cosmetic fixes into your budget or use them as negotiation points.
- Maintenance History Gaps: Not all vehicles come with complete service records.
- Solution: The VHR can fill some gaps. Prioritize vehicles with well-documented maintenance. A PPI is even more critical in such cases.
- Air Suspension Concerns: While providing a superior ride, the air suspension system can be costly to repair if components fail.
- Solution: The PPI must specifically check the air suspension for leaks, compressor health, and sensor functionality. Inquire about its service history. Consider an extended warranty if this is a major concern.
- Finding the Right Configuration: The exact combination of engine, drivetrain (2WD/4WD), bed length, and specific options might be scarce.
- Solution: Be patient and expand your search radius. Set alerts on online marketplaces for new listings.
- "As Is" Sales: Most private party sales are "as is," meaning no warranty.
- Solution: Emphasize the PPI. Consider purchasing an aftermarket extended warranty for peace of mind, especially for higher mileage vehicles.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: What is the best year for a used Ram 1500 Limited?
A1: For the current generation (DT), 2019 was the first model year. Later years (2020-2023) may have minor refinements or updated tech features. The "best" year depends on your budget and desire for the absolute latest features versus maximum depreciation savings. 2021-2022 often represent a sweet spot for value and modern features.
Q2: Are used Ram 1500 Limiteds reliable?
A2: Generally, yes. The Ram 1500, especially with the 5.7L HEMI, has a strong reputation for durability. Like any vehicle, reliability depends heavily on previous maintenance. Always check the service records and get a pre-purchase inspection.
Q3: Is the air suspension on the Ram 1500 Limited reliable?
A3: The Active-Level Four-Corner Air Suspension is a sophisticated system that provides a fantastic ride. While generally reliable, like any complex system, components (compressor, airbags, sensors) can eventually wear out. Repairs can be costly. A thorough pre-purchase inspection should specifically check the health of this system.
Q4: How much does maintenance cost for a used Ram 1500 Limited?
A4: Maintenance costs are comparable to other full-size trucks. Regular oil changes, tire rotations, and filter replacements are standard. Larger services, like spark plugs or brake jobs, will be more expensive. Factor in potential costs for the air suspension or other advanced features as the truck ages.
Q5: Should I buy a Certified Pre-Owned (CPO) Ram 1500 Limited?
A5: If budget allows, CPO is highly recommended. It offers a factory-backed warranty, a rigorous inspection, and often perks like roadside assistance. This significantly reduces the risk associated with buying used, especially for a premium vehicle like the Limited.
Q6: What is considered good mileage for a used Ram 1500 Limited?
A6: For a modern truck, 12,000-15,000 miles per year is typical. A 3-year-old truck with 36,000-45,000 miles would be considered good. High mileage isn’t necessarily a deal-breaker if the truck has excellent maintenance records and passes a comprehensive inspection.
